Unfortunately, Instagram doesn't provide a way to see if someone has taken a screenshot of your story. This is mainly for privacy reasons. While it might seem a bit inconvenient if you're sharing something exclusive on your story, it also means that users can interact with your content without the fear of being 'caught' screenshotting.

Instagram doesn't offer a feature to show if someone has screenshotted your photo. It's a privacy - related decision. While it might seem inconvenient for some who want to protect their content, it also gives freedom to users to capture and save things they like privately. If you're worried about your photos being shared without permission, you could consider adding watermarks or using Instagram's privacy settings to limit who can view your photos in the first place.
